Greensboro

Greensboro is a moderately sized city in central North Carolina. With a population of about 250,000, it is the third largest city in the state. It is not a particularly popular tourist destination, but the city's downtown has experienced a revitalization in recent years. There are an increasing number of bars, music venues, and restaurants in the area that you can enjoy. It's location at the intersection of the major interstates (I-85, I-40 and I-73) mean that many travelers at least pass through this area at some point during their time in North Carolina.

Saint Thomas

Saint Thomas is a beautiful island in the U.S. Virgin Islands. Together with St. John, St. Croix, and Water Island, it forms the unincorporated territory of the United States. The island is also home to the territorial capital and port of Charlotte Amalie. The island's population is just over 50,000, which is slightly less than half of the territory's total population.

When is the best time to visit Greensboro or Saint Thomas?

Greensboro has a temperate climate with four distinct seasons, but Saint Thomas experiences a warm climate with fairly sunny weather most of the year.

Should I visit Greensboro or Saint Thomas in the Summer?

Both Saint Thomas and Greensboro during the summer are popular places to visit. The family-friendly experiences are the main draw to Greensboro this time of year. Warm weather and sunshine bring visitors to Saint Thomas year-round.

In July, Greensboro is generally around the same temperature as Saint Thomas. Daily temperatures in Greensboro average around 81°F (27°C), and Saint Thomas fluctuates around 29°C (83°F).

In Saint Thomas, it's very sunny this time of the year. It's quite sunny in Greensboro. In the summer, Greensboro often gets around the same amount of sunshine as Saint Thomas. Greensboro gets 273 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Saint Thomas receives 287 hours of full sun.

It rains a lot this time of the year in Greensboro. Greensboro usually gets more rain in July than Saint Thomas. Greensboro gets 4.4 inches (112 mm) of rain, while Saint Thomas receives 66 mm (2.6 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Greensboro or Saint Thomas in the Autumn?

The autumn attracts plenty of travelers to both Greensboro and Saint Thomas. Many travelers come to Greensboro for the shopping scene. Saint Thomas attracts visitors year-round for its warm weather and sunny climate.

Greensboro is much colder than Saint Thomas in the autumn. The daily temperature in Greensboro averages around 62°F (17°C) in October, and Saint Thomas fluctuates around 28°C (82°F).

People are often attracted to the plentiful sunshine in Saint Thomas this time of the year. In Greensboro, it's very sunny this time of the year. Greensboro usually receives less sunshine than Saint Thomas during autumn. Greensboro gets 212 hours of sunny skies, while Saint Thomas receives 235 hours of full sun in the autumn.

Saint Thomas receives a lot of rain in the autumn. In October, Greensboro usually receives less rain than Saint Thomas. Greensboro gets 3 inches (75 mm) of rain, while Saint Thomas receives 146 mm (5.7 in) of rain each month for the autumn.

Should I visit Greensboro or Saint Thomas in the Winter?

The winter brings many poeple to Greensboro as well as Saint Thomas. Many visitors come to Greensboro in the winter for the museums, the shopping scene, and the cuisine. The warm climate attracts visitors to Saint Thomas throughout the year.

Greensboro can get quite cold in the winter. In the winter, Greensboro is much colder than Saint Thomas. Typically, the winter temperatures in Greensboro in January average around 40°F (4°C), and Saint Thomas averages at about 26°C (78°F).

The sun comes out a lot this time of the year in Saint Thomas. In the winter, Greensboro often gets less sunshine than Saint Thomas. Greensboro gets 169 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Saint Thomas receives 240 hours of full sun.

Greensboro usually gets more rain in January than Saint Thomas. Greensboro gets 3.2 inches (82 mm) of rain, while Saint Thomas receives 43 mm (1.7 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Greensboro or Saint Thomas in the Spring?

Both Saint Thomas and Greensboro are popular destinations to visit in the spring with plenty of activities. Plenty of visitors come to Saint Thomas because of the warm climate and sunshine that lasts throughout the year.

In April, Greensboro is generally much colder than Saint Thomas. Daily temperatures in Greensboro average around 61°F (16°C), and Saint Thomas fluctuates around 27°C (80°F).

It's quite sunny in Saint Thomas. The sun comes out a lot this time of the year in Greensboro. Greensboro usually receives less sunshine than Saint Thomas during spring. Greensboro gets 248 hours of sunny skies, while Saint Thomas receives 272 hours of full sun in the spring.

In April, Greensboro usually receives more rain than Saint Thomas. Greensboro gets 3.1 inches (80 mm) of rain, while Saint Thomas receives 72 mm (2.8 in) of rain each month for the spring.
